After-surgery home health care involves professional assistance provided in your home to help you recover from a surgical procedure, whether it was performed in a hospital or outpatient facility. Post-surgical care involves a range of services designed to support your recovery. These may include:
- Wound Care: Skilled nurses provide professional wound care, ensuring your surgical site heals properly.
- Assistance with Daily Living Activities: Certified Home Health Aides (CHHAs) and professional caregivers can help with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, and meal preparation, making your recovery period more manageable.
- Medication Management: Skilled nurses and CHHAs can help ensure medications are taken correctly and on time, preventing any adverse effects or complications.
- Therapy Services: Physical, occupational, and speech therapists can support recovery at home to help regain independence.
Preparing for Home Health Care After Surgery
Preparation is key to a successful recovery. Here are some steps you can take to ensure you are ready for home care after your surgery:
- Communicate with Your Doctor: Discuss your post-surgery care needs with your doctor. They can provide recommendations and guidelines to help you prepare.
- Set Up Your Home: Arrange your home to accommodate your recovery needs. This may involve setting up a comfortable resting area, ensuring easy access to essential items, and removing any hazards that could cause falls.
- Plan for Assistance: Coordinate with family members and professional caregivers to ensure you have the support you need during your recovery.
- Stock Up on Supplies: Ensure you have all necessary medical supplies, medications, and personal care items readily available.
- Follow Your Care Plan: Adhere to the care plan developed by your healthcare providers, including attending follow-up appointments and therapy sessions.
Family members play a vital role in your recovery. Their involvement can provide emotional support, help with daily living activities, and ensure you adhere to your care plan. It’s important to communicate openly with your family about your needs and any concerns you may have.
